My PS3 TftB has been rendered unplayable. The constant crashes every time I pause and agonizing Skyrim-esqe load times were bad enough, but now whenever I select Play from the options menu, the game goes to the episode I'm on, and the music keeps playing but no button does anything except for the home button. Also, oddly enough, the shoulder button prompts to switch between episodes are not visible, but this hardly matters I guess since no button does anything at all. I'm really upset by this because story-wise this game is a total masterpiece, but performance wise it's unacceptably atrocious.


 


Anyhow, I was curious if anyone has had this happen to them, and if so how to fix it.

The game runs so, so much better now that I've defraged my PS3.  I was gonna say it ran great, but when I paused the game to type this comment it crashed again, so it's still definitely got issues, but it's a huge step up from before where it crashed every other time I paused.  Load times are about a third of what they were before: before the defrag they were worse than Skyrim, now they're bearable.
